Logo androidermagazine.com
Logo androidermagazine.com

Warum Ubuntu für Android erfolgreich sein kann, wo andere versagten

Inhaltsverzeichnis:

Anonim

Sie haben wahrscheinlich die großen Neuigkeiten über die Pläne von Canonical gehört, Ubuntu für Android-Geräte zu entwickeln. Es ist etwas, worüber ich sehr aufgeregt bin und das ich seit den Tagen des Nexus One an mir selbst herumgebastelt habe. Diese neueste - und letztendlich offizielle - Iteration ähnelt etwas, das wir zuvor von Motorola - Webtop gesehen haben (und es wird damit verglichen). Wir müssen uns hinsetzen und diese Woche mit den Leuten von Canonical über Ubuntu für Android sprechen, und ich bin hier, um Ihnen zu sagen, dass dies wahrscheinlich nicht wie Webtop sein wird.

Es wird nicht saugen. Und hier ist warum:

Wo das Lapdock floppte, wird Ubuntu triumphieren

Leg deine Mistgabeln weg, ich habe gesagt, dass ich liebe, was Motorola mit Webtop versucht hat, seit ich den Atrix hatte. Es ist innovativ und ein Gebiet, das unbedingt erkundet werden muss. Motorola hat Sie gezwungen, teures Zubehör zu verwenden, und versucht, die Erfahrung einzuschränken. Android-Hacker haben, da sie dazu neigen, das Webtop-Erlebnis verbessert, indem sie es verwurzelt und ein wenig geöffnet haben, aber es ist vom Design her immer noch begrenzt. Und genau hier hat Canonical mit Ubuntu für Android den richtigen Weg eingeschlagen.

Da ich eine Art Linux-Evangelist bin (der alles mitbekommen hat) und auch ein langjähriger Linux-Benutzer bin, war ich sehr interessiert an dem, was wir über Ubuntu für Android gehört haben, und habe ein paar Fragen gestellt, die die meisten Leute wahrscheinlich nicht stellen würden haben. Und ich mochte die Antworten, die ich bekam. Anstatt zu versuchen, die Ubuntu-Erfahrung auf das zu beschränken, was sie für wünschenswert halten, wird es sich um eine umfassende, ehrliche Ubuntu-Installation handeln, die zusammen mit Android ausgeführt wird. Umfassende Verwaltungstools, der vollständige Paket-Manager und alles, was Sie sich jemals von einem Desktop-Betriebssystem wünschen würden.

Es ist Ubuntu für Android, nicht Ubuntu für Android

Android läuft auf dem Linux-Kernel. Ubuntu läuft auf dem Linux-Kernel. Wir betrachten einen Kernel mit Modulen und Treibern für die gesamte Hardware, und nur die dem Benutzer präsentierten Prozesse ändern sich je nach der Art und Weise, wie der Bildschirm angezeigt wird. Schließen Sie Ihr Telefon über den HDMI-Ausgang an einen Monitor an, und die Prozesse, mit denen Sie Android auf Ihrem Telefon erhalten, werden angehalten und die Prozesse, mit denen Sie Ubuntu auf dem Desktop erhalten, werden initialisiert. Sinn ergeben?

Auf diese Weise ist Ihre Desktop-Erfahrung nicht von dem Android-Betriebssystem abhängig, das auf Ihrem Telefon ausgeführt wird. Mit anderen Worten, es ist nicht wirklich Ubuntu auf Android. Es ist Ubuntu mit Android.

Es ist auch keine Dual-Boot-Lösung - sie wird dynamisch ausgeführt und ausgelöst, wenn Sie einen externen Monitor anschließen. Da alles auf demselben Kernel läuft, können Sie einfach hin und her springen. So sollte es gemacht werden.

Habe HDMI Kabel, werde reisen

Und es wird keine teure und schwer zu findende Hardware geben. Jedes HDMI-Kabel sowie jede Bluetooth-Tastatur und -Maus funktionieren. Wir sind uns ziemlich sicher, dass einige OEM-Zubehörteile irgendwann verfügbar sein werden, und sie werden ganz nett sein, aber diese billige Tastatur- und Mauskombination, die Sie aus 5 unten ausgewählt haben, wird auch funktionieren. Das Nicht-Benötigen eines 100-Dollar-Docks wird dies für alle zugänglicher machen. Selbst eine Laptop-Hülle muss kein teures OEM-Modell sein, und ich sehe, dass Unternehmen eine universelle Lösung zu einem angemessenen Preis anbieten, wenn der Markt dafür da ist.

Der größte Unterschied wird in der Software liegen. Schließen Sie Ihr Motorola-Telefon an die Webtop-Appliance an, und Sie erhalten eine grundlegende, sehr eingeschränkte und schwer anpassbare Erfahrung. Sie sind auf Motorola angewiesen, um die Software zu warten und bereitzustellen, und es hat einfach keine sehr gute Arbeit geleistet. (Nicht, dass es einfach wäre, aber trotzdem.)

Mit Ubuntu haben Sie eine normale Installation für ARM-Prozessoren. Sie können es auf die gleiche Weise wie auf Ihrem Desktop anpassen, indem Sie dieselben Tools verwenden und vollen Zugriff auf den Paketmanager von Synaptic - Ubuntu haben. Sobald die Dokumentation und die Quellköpfe verfügbar sind, kann jeder eine beliebige Software erstellen und sie so anpassen, dass sie für die Verwendung mit Ubuntu unter Android optimiert ist. Alle großartigen Open-Source-Programme, die wir kennen und lieben, können (und werden es mit Sicherheit) mit speziellen Compiler-Flags erstellt werden, um sie an die ARMbuntu-Hardware anzupassen. Das Endergebnis werden Programme sein, die so ausgeführt werden, wie es die Hardware zulässt. Chrom, Firefox, Gimp, wie Sie es nennen - alles ist möglich.

Die Android-Community wird einen großen Tag damit verbringen, und die riesige Ubuntu-Entwickler-Community wird es ebenfalls tun. Die Demo, die wir gesehen haben, war sehr flüssig und hatte einige großartige Funktionen, aber wenn die Geeks und Nerds davon erfahren, bin ich mir ziemlich sicher, dass es etwas Erstaunliches werden wird.

Eine für die Nerds

Ubuntu ist ein Open-Source-Desktop-Betriebssystem. Dies bedeutet, dass der Quellcode für alles, egal wie groß oder klein es ist, für Leute wie Sie und ich zur Verfügung steht, mit denen Sie basteln können. Sie denken, es gibt viele benutzerdefinierte ROMs für Android? Warten Sie, bis Sie sehen, was mit Ubuntu möglich ist. Jedes Element der Benutzeroberfläche kann geändert werden, ebenso alles, was sich hinter den Kulissen abspielt. Und Sie brauchen keine besonderen Fähigkeiten, um es zu versuchen - öffnen Sie einfach die Einstellungen und ändern Sie sich. Die Verwendung von Standards und Open-Source-Software in Kombination mit Millionen von Benutzern macht Ubuntu zum König der Desktop-Anpassung, und Benutzeroberflächen-Add-Ins wie Desklets und Docks bedeuten, dass keine zwei Maschinen gleich aussehen.

Mit Ubuntu nicht vertraute Entwickler und Modder werden außer sich sein, und diejenigen, die Ubuntu bereits auf ihrem Heim-Desktop verwenden, werden dazu angeregt, ihre Kreationen für Ubuntu auf Android neu zu programmieren. Da natürlich alles offen ist und der Code für alle verfügbar ist, wird dies auch auf unsere vorhandenen Telefone und Tablets zurückportiert. Unsere neu gegründeten Ubuntu für Android-Foren werden springen, und ich bin gleich da, wenn ihr Spaß habt.

Es gibt jedoch einen Haken …

Seien wir ehrlich, Ubuntu, das auf diese Weise neben Android läuft, ist nicht jedermanns Sache. Und das ist gut so. Der andere Haken ist, dass Sie es nicht auf ein altes Telefon stecken können. Abgesehen von den Hardwareanforderungen (denken Sie an Dual-Core als Low-End), ist Ubuntu in diesem Fall nicht nur eine Anwendung, die Sie aus dem Android Market herunterladen und installieren. Der Code muss speziell kompiliert und in ein ROM gebacken werden.

Es ist denkbar, dass wir die aktuellen Spediteure und Hersteller sehen, aber wir werden nicht die Farm auf dem Markt sein. (Und angesichts ihrer Erfolgsgeschichte bei Updates ist das nicht unbedingt eine schlechte Sache.) Wenn Sie dies lesen und sich überhaupt für Linux interessieren, wird das kein großes Problem sein. Aber es ist etwas zu beachten.

Wir werden mehr über die Verfügbarkeit erfahren, wenn wir auf dem Mobile World Congress mit Canonical sprechen, und Sie können wetten, dass wir alle auf dem Laufenden halten. Es ist Zeit, wieder aufgeregt zu werden!